Sat 1276579379426249

decimal
300631.1879426249
degree
0°90631′247″1879426249‴
percentile
60.78949432526129%
name
euqaxdtjpga
cycle
0
epoch
1
period
149
block
300631
offset
1879426249
timestamp
rarity
common
inscriptions
location
ae12e1de7ec460b1840f80ae52142262838e68bd18e4b8ab346a89ad9ac82dbc:15:950354463
address
bc1quzherxnjs9w2ppczdjp0spcqqyz4yqp4apkp4n